




Kewan
Grounded Dining Chair
-
2025
Furniture and Decorative Items Design
Sima Dabaghi, Mohsen Dadipour
-
KEWAN reinterprets low-level dining as a contemporary design concept, inspired by the traditional Iranian and Eastern practice of gathering around a Sofreh. Rather than nostalgia, the project focuses on calmness, simplicity, and spatial connection. The design is inspired by the cosmic symbolism of Keyvan (Saturn), representing balance and order, and combines cultural geometry with grounded ergonomics. The chair is formed through geometric Rasmibandi logic and transformed into a folded three-dimensional human-scale volume. The body is made of 3 mm anodized aluminum sheet with bending and TIG welding, featuring rounded edges for comfort. The seat uses HR foam upholstered with hand-embroidered Balochi textile and detachable Velcro fixation for easy maintenance. KEWAN aims to redefine dining furniture by integrating cultural heritage, structural geometry, and human-centered low seating ergonomics into a single design system.
